Yoga has become a trending way to boost flexibility, muscle strength, and mental sharpness. For yoga beginners, getting into yoga can be both motivating and confusing with the wide range of poses to practice. To help you start off, here are some essential yoga poses that are perfect for yoga newcomers.



1. Mountain Pose

This pose is the base of all yoga stances. Though it may appear easy, it’s all about stability and posture. Stand with your legs together or just apart, arms at your sides, and distribute your weight evenly across both feet. Strengthen your thighs, lift your chest, and press your shoulders down. This pose helps fix your posture and provides a sense of centeredness.

2. Downward Dog

Downward Dog is a key element in many yoga sequences. Start on your hands and legs, then lift your glutes toward the ceiling, extending your legs and creating an inverted “V” shape with your body. Keep your hands even with your shoulders and feet apart at hip distance. This pose elongates the hamstrings, shoulders, and calves while strengthening the arms and legs. It also helps to reduce mental stress and lower stress levels.

3. Warrior I

Virabhadrasana I is a strong pose that enhances power in the legs and core. Begin in a upright stance, take a backward step, and bend forward while keeping the back leg strong. Lift your arms above you, with palms together. This pose helps balance, increases stamina, and expands the chest and hips.

4. Pose of the Child

Balasana is a relaxing position that provides a easy stretch for the back, hips, and thighs. Start on your all fours, then sit back on your hips and move your arms forward, lowering your forehead to the mat. It’s great for relaxing between more difficult movements or quieting your thoughts when feeling overwhelmed.

5. Vrksasana

Vrksasana is a beneficial balance pose for new practitioners. Stand tall, balance your weight onto one foot, and place the sole of your free foot on your calf or calf (avoid the knee). Place your palms together in front of your chest or lift them toward the sky. This pose strengthens your legs, improves balance, and enhances concentration.

These five yoga poses are perfect for beginners to start building a strong foundation. By concentrating on proper alignment and breathing, you'll be advancing to experiencing the benefits of yoga, both in body and mind. Best of luck!
